Get a first look at DC Horror’s The Conjuring: The Lover #1

May 8, 2021 by Amie Cranswick

Last month it was announced that DC Comics is set to launch a new DC Horror imprint beginning with a limited series set within the world of The Conjuring Universe, and now we’ve got our first look at The Conjuring: The Lover #1 with the release of some unlettered artwork from series artist Garry Brown. This dark and haunting mystery is co-written by Daniel Johnson-McGoldrick (screenwriter, The Conjuring 2, Orphan) and Rex Ogle. The prelude introduces college student Jessica, a college freshman returning to campus after winter break, bringing with her the anxieties of last semester’s poor grades, the awkwardness of facing a boy she wishes she’d never slept with, and an undeniably unnerving feeling of being watched.

Jessica soon comes to realize that something evil has made her its target, and it will not rest until it has her in its unholy grip. But why did this sinister presence set its sights on a seemingly normal college freshman?

The Conjuring: The Lover #1 goes on sale on June 4th.
